Design and Construction Characteristics
Structure
- Outer Cylinder: The external shell housing multiple internal stages.
- Internal Stage: Gradual expansion mechanism with two or three-stage designs.
- Piston: Component responsible for pushing hydraulic fluid.
- Seals: Various types like O-rings and wiper seals to prevent leaks.
- Materials: High-strength steel, lightweight aluminum, corrosion-resistant coatings.

Working Principle
The telescopic single-acting hydraulic cylinder operates by applying hydraulic pressure in one direction to extend its length from a compact form. It then contracts using a spring or gravity. This mechanism allows for versatile applications in lifting and driving scenarios.
